Union Yoga + Wellness

This community-based yoga studio offers a variety of different classes including $15 Beginner Yoga, Hot Flow, and Restorative + Gentle Yoga to name a few. Union Yoga + Wellness studio is based on Bloor Street West, but they also offer online class options so you can enjoy a class wherever you are!

Chi Junky Studio

If you love a little music while you get your sweat on, Chi Junky might just be the yoga studio for you! Every class has music involved, from heavy beats to keep you moving to slower music to help soothe. You can opt to go class-by-class or buy a membership if you end up loving it! Not experienced? No problem. The expert yoga instructors provide modifications as needed for any class. 

BeHot Yoga

BeHot Yoga of course offers hot yoga classes, as implied in the name, but that’s not all! They also offer Vinyasa Yoga, Yin Yoga, and HOT-HiiT Pilates! They have 2 yoga rooms. One heated at 40 degrees for Original Hot Yoga and one kept at 30-34 degrees for a comfortable, warm yoga experience. The studio has a variety of class rate options and they even offer what they call an “Energy Exchange”, where you can help out for 2-3 hours a week, cleaning the studio for a great deal on unlimited yoga classes.
